Financial Analyst III (Charlotte, NC)

Optomi, in partnership with a leader in the telecommunications industry, is seeking a Financial Analyst III with strong financial planning & analysis (FP&A) experience to support large-scale budgeting and forecasting operations. This is a high-impact role that directly supports financial strategy for a multi-billion-dollar supply chain operation. The ideal candidate is a polished, detail-oriented profess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ment and has a passion for driving clarity and insights from financial data.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Build, manage, and improve detailed budgets and forecasts from scratch using financial data from internal stakeholders.
  • Perform advanced Excel-based financial modeling and data analysis to support strategic planning.
  • Translate complex financial data into meaningful insights and written commentary for executive leadership.
  • Serve as the liaison between business users and technical/engineering teams to improve systems and tools.
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ives by enhancing existing Excel tools and building new ones.
  • Work cross-functionally with various business units within and outside of the supply chain to gather data and meet deadlines.
  • Track and document system issues, identifying opportunities for process optimization.

Required Qualifications:

  • 5–10 years of experience in financial analysis, business analysis, or FP&A roles.
  • Advanced Excel skills including pivot tables, VLOOKUPs, and strong financial modeling capability.
  • Proven experience in budgeting, forecasting, and driving insights through data.
  • Strong written communication skills — must be able to write commentary and clearly explain variances, trends, and financial impacts.
  • Ability to handle high-volume, high-visibility deliverables with accuracy and professionalism.
  • Experience working with large-scale budgets (hundreds of millions to billions).
  • Strong organizational and time-management skills to juggle competing priorities in a deadline-driven environment.

Preferred (Nice to Have):

  • Experience with SAP and/or Hyperion.
  • Familiarity with CapEx and OpEx planning processes.
